French organist and composer, Marcel Dupré (1886-1971) is also remembered as a significant pedagogue. However, his prominence within the Organ repertoire remains absolute with sublime works, including his Variations On A Noel.

Dupré studied at the Paris Conservatoire with Louis Vierne and Charles-Marie Widor, where he won prizes for Piano, Organ and fugue, as well as the Grand Prix de Rome. He was a famous Organ virtuoso and was able to perform the entire works composed for the instrument by J. S. Bach from memory. Dupré’s Op.20, the Variations On A Noelfor Organ was composed in 1922. It is based on an old Noel (Pastorale) in D minor. The variations displays contrast through tonality, rhythm, timbre and harmony, among other aspects. Dupré’s compositions and didactic works remain important to organists today and his Variations On A Noel is no exception.
